I recently installed new clear tail lights we ordered from Rich @ Redpants. Decided to go with the black vs grey trim. Have been thinking about doing this for a while, however when the original left tail light got wet inside, after driving through a major downpour while returning home from our daughter's place, it damaged the electronics. Took it apart and dried it out but no luck, so that pushed us over the edge in the decision to go with the clear. The right tail light survived unscathed, so if any one needs a right side, red tail light in excellent shape let me know.
During the install of the new lights, I could see where an improper install could potentially cause the lens to separate from the body, especially at the leading edge where the light wraps around the rear quarter panel. That could open up just enough of a crack to left moisture in.
Also swapped out the battery with a new AGM unit. I keep the car on a CTEK tender when it's not use however, recently it was slow to turn over on a couple of occasions, plus I was getting instances when the side windows would drop but not automatically go back up when opening / closing the doors. Resetting the windows stops didn't help. Since the new battery haven't had an issue.... so far.
Is it possible the car still had the original battery from the factory since 2007? We've had the car for 2 years and I looked through the service history and didn't see any mention of a replacement. It had the Aston Martin logo

Much like the headlights the tailights are assembled flawed. Having examined both the red and clear versions there’s no difference in the lack o& a full and consistent seal. They have intermittent sealing that will permit water to enter. If you correct this and seal them properly they fail to exhal3 suffiently and exhibit condensation issues.
If you don’t want the clear set to eventually succumb to the same issues the red set endured you should address these two issues while the set are fully functioning. There is a thread on here that documents correcting the sealing issue and reworking them to allow the necessary exhaling as the internals heat up.
